Address 0 PPC

PDCWpiVQU4eoDkFVqsJC9YbpyJsCS1DTXi

Confirmed

Total Received681.491496 PPC
Total Sent681.491496 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PDCWpiVQU4eoDkFVqsJC9YbpyJsCS1DTXi681.491496 PPC
Fee: 0.01 PPC
711256 Confirmations681.481496 PPC
PDCWpiVQU4eoDkFVqsJC9YbpyJsCS1DTXi681.491496 PPC
PD5HnDs9uF59iXoXytfwhXhxVo3nQKDQk23.101181 PPC
Fee: 0.01 PPC
711257 Confirmations684.592677 PPC